Hi Everyone,
We have fixed this bug in our latest release – v 24.2.1 which is available worldwide now. Thanks for your patience on this.
Please note that after upgrading you might still see that Align To sets itself to Align to Key Object. If you see this, please manually set the Align To to the required setting, and this reported bug will not happen again. You'll need to this one time only.

Thanks Ton. This is a bug.
When you select multiple objects for first time after launch, Ai sets Align To to ‘Align to Key Object’. This should not be happening. Also, if you switch to ‘Align to Key Object’ from ‘Align to Artboard/Selection’ while working, Align To setting gets stuck on Key Object (rather than going back to selection/artboard after aligning to key object). We are working on a fix for this.
As a workaround, you’d have to manually change the Align To settings either from the Align Panel (Align Panel > Show Options> Align To dropdown) or from the control bar (settings at the top of Ai).
